Founder Bio

Geri Stengel
Founder and President

“A baby boomer with the heart and soul of a millennial” describes Geri best. She grew up believing that dedicated, thoughtful people can change the world by working together.

She is a believer still. In fact, Geri is even more committed to the possibility of meaningful change because she realizes that we have a huge, untapped resource: Women!

For the last few years, Geri has researched and written about the challenges women face in the entrepreneurial world and the success factors that help them break through barriers, whether they are starting a business or scaling to a multi-million dollar enterprise.

Geri’s passion to get women on the radar as leaders of mega-firms led her to write Forget the Glass Ceiling: Build Your Business Without One. To find out best practices for investment crowdfunding — a great alternative for women entrepreneurs! — Geri undertook a successful rewards-based crowdfunding campaign herself and published the results in  Stand Out in the Crowd:  How Women (and Men) Benefit from Equity Crowdfunding [add link]

Geri is a questioner and a builder, and is passionate about eliminating barriers to entrepreneurial aspirations.

Geri’s accomplishments include:

  • Mentor for WE NYC: 2016 to present
  • 2015 Madam C.J. Walker Business Leadership Award from the National Minority Business Council.
  • 2013 and 2012 Small Business Trends Small Business Influencer
  • Adjunct Professor of Entrepreneurship at The New School
  • Facilitator, Kauffman Foundation FastTrac courses for entrepreneurs
  • Researched and published Ditch Digital Dabbling: How Small Businesses + Nonprofits Can Master Online Marketing
  • Former board member for the New York City Chapter of the National Association of Women Business Owners. Was on the board for eight years.
